Jimmy carter did not nominate a supreme court justice during his presidency true false

History
2 answers:
faltersainse [42]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

True

Explanation:

Jimmy Carter was the United States president from 1977 to 1981. He is now a philanthropist, mainly working through the Carter Center. One of Carter's most significant policies were pardoning all of the Vietnam War draft evaders. He also established the Department of Energy and the Department of Education. However, Carter did not nominate a Supreme Court Justice during his presidency.
